In the era of big data and digital information, the importance of organizing, managing, and making sense of data has become increasingly vital. This is where taxonomy comes into play. Taxonomy is a systematic classification, categorization, and organization of information based on specific criteria. It has long been an essential tool in information science and knowledge management, helping to bring order to complex data sets and making it easier for users to find and access the information they need.
The Role of Taxonomy in Information Science
In information science, taxonomy plays a crucial role in organizing and categorizing information to make it more accessible and usable. It involves creating a hierarchical structure that groups similar concepts together and differentiates between distinct ones. This hierarchy can be based on various factors, such as subject matter, format, or audience.
Taxonomy is used in a variety of information science applications, including libraries, museums, and archives. It helps librarians and archivists to create catalogs and finding aids that allow users to efficiently locate the information they need. In the digital age, taxonomy is also used to power search engines and recommendation systems, ensuring that users are presented with relevant and accurate results.
The Role of Taxonomy in Knowledge Management
Knowledge management is the process of capturing, distributing, and effectively using knowledge within an organization. Taxonomy is a critical component of knowledge management, as it enables organizations to classify and organize their knowledge assets in a way that makes sense to their users. This can include everything from documents and databases to expertise and best practices.
By using taxonomy to categorize knowledge assets, organizations can ensure that their employees can easily find and access the information they need to do their jobs. This can lead to increased productivity, improved decision-making, and better overall organizational performance.
